Westbury Art Centre: Moths & Insects In Westbury's Gardens

Join us as we learn about the moths and insects found in the lovely gardens at Westbury Arts Centre.

Members of MK Natural History Society have been studying moths and other insects at Westbury for the past decade. Moth traps will be set up in the grounds overnight and in the morning we will look at the contents of these traps, identifying the diverse moth species - together with other nocturnal insects - which find their way into them. We will discuss the incredible variety of UK moths, their natural history and what makes Westbury such a good site for them.
WHO IS THIS WORKSHOP SUITABLE FOR:
- Adults or children
- Children under 18 years old must be accompanied by an adult. - Children and adults need a valid ticket.
- Please note that regrettably wheelchair access is difficult in the gardens at Westbury. We are sorry and hope to be able to invest in more suitable pathways in the future.
